Includes 3 pieces: Top Mold, Bottom Mold, and Removable Insert. Approximately 6-1/2" diameter x 7"H. Non-Stick, Dishwasher safe, Oven safe, Fridge/Freezer safe.

By CK (The Mini Apple, MN)
My kids saw the ads for this on Nickelodeon and begged for it. I gave in for my daughter's 6th birthday. Our results were good, and when decorated the cake was great. We love it! A couple notes: the instructions provided with the set aren't great. They say that the bottom takes longer than the top to cook. I found the opposite to be true -- especially when using the insert. And if you do any cake mix doctoring the times can be very different from the instructions. I've baked it for as long as an hour (convection oven at 325 degrees, which matches 350 degrees in regular oven). The insert has worked well each time we use it, you do have to make sure it's snapped in all the way around. I never cut cake off the top layer before assembling, and it works fine. MORAL OF THE STORY: this works, just set your timer for the time on the box indicated for BUNDT cake (because it's thick like a bundt), test with a pick, be prepared to bake longer if needed until it tests done. It's so much fun to decorate and you get a great reaction when you serve it. Seems smaller than a cake, but it serves just as many. Don't let the size fool you.
